English Translation by
Abdullah Yusuf Ali






28.. And even if thou hast to turn away from
them in pursuit of the Mercy from thy Lord which thou dost expect, yet
speak to them a word of easy kindness.


29. Make not thy hand tied (like a niggard's)
to thy neck, nor stretch it forth to its utmost reach, so that thou
become blameworthy and destitute.


30. Verily thy Lord doth provide sustenance in
abundance for whom He pleaseth, and He provideth in a just measure. For
He doth know and regard all His servants.


31. Kill not your children for fear of want: We
shall provide sustenance for them as well as for you. Verily the
killing of them is a great sin.


32. Nor come nigh to adultery: for it is a shameful (deed) and an evil, opening 
the road (to other evils).


33. Nor take life - which Allah has made sacred
- except for just cause. And if anyone is slain wrongfully, we have
given his heir authority (to demand qisas or to forgive): but let him
nor exceed bounds in the matter of taking life; for he is helped (by
the Law).


34. Come not nigh to the orphan's property
except to improve it, until he attains the age of full strength; and
fulfil (every) engagement, for (every) engagement will be enquired into
(on the Day of Reckoning).


35. Give full measure when ye measure, and
weigh with a balance that is straight: that is the most fitting and the
most advantageous in the final determination.


36. And pursue not that of which thou hast no
knowledge; for every act of hearing, or of seeing or of (feeling in)
the heart will be enquired into (on the Day of Reckoning).


37. Nor walk on the earth with insolence: for thou canst not rend the earth 
asunder, nor reach the mountains in height.


38. Of all such things the evil is hateful in the sight of thy Lord.
